Across 4-6 workshops, we focus on cutting-edge research looking at how leaders can unlock their ‘real human’ leadership potential in a practical and transferable way.

One of our Key Principles of Workplace AI is to ‘Be Unique or Become Extinct’: to protect our relevance in the workplace we must maximise our human potential, and make sure we do the things that only humans can do really well. No human could ever hold as much knowledge as Google, Siri or Viv, but what we do have is fluid intelligence. As yet, human curiosity cannot be synthesised, and thus it should be nurtured and respected. A robot can learn how to develop rapport, but intimacy is uniquely human.

Continuous learning
  • Employers need to help people feel empowered and thrive amid these changes. 

  • For example, investing in personal development can be cost-effective. The cost of replacing an employee can be up to 213% of their annual salary for executive positions. 

  • So, investing in training is often cheaper than hiring new staff. This not only motivates employees but also empowers them with more versatility in the future.

  • Continuous learning is crucial. No one knows everything, and adapting to new roles requires ongoing skill development. 

  • Staying informed about industry trends and learning from others is vital. 

  • If an organisation doesn’t invest in its people, it risks losing them to competitors who will.
